Basedow's unwavering belief in the transformative power of education fueled his relentless efforts to reform the prevailing educational practices of the 18th century. The author delves into the philosophical underpinnings of Basedow's educational system, which emphasized the paramount importance of educating the whole childâ"intellectually, morally, and physically. Basedow's innovative methods, such as incorporating sense-perceptions into teaching, laid the groundwork for modern educational approaches. Furthermore, the book highlights Basedow's unwavering advocacy for state involvement in education to ensure accessibility for all children. His unwavering commitment to improving the quality of education for all societal strata left an indelible mark on the field. Through a comprehensive analysis of Basedow's life and work, this book not only sheds light on his pedagogical legacy but also serves as a compelling reminder of the ongoing quest to enhance educational practices.
